Father: Isaac Eldridge Spangler
Mother: Ethel Beatrice Craighead
Wife:
Alma Elizabeth Blankenship
Married 1964 - Divorced 1967.
Never married again
Children: None

Jona loved people especially children. Jona was active in several Blacksburg Youth Groups. His passions were gardening and music. Jona played the guitar. When Jona's brother John Winfield Spangler became bed ridden, Jona assisted him in researching family genealogy through Church, Court and Cemetery Records and Archives.

Jonathan W. Spangler, 69, of Blacksburg, went to be with the Lord Tuesday, November 11, 2014, in Lewis Gale Medical Center in Montgomery County. John was born August 13, 1945, in Shawsville, and was one of 10 children born to Isaac E. Spangler and Ethel B. Craighead.He was preceded by his eight brothers and is survived by his one sister; along with three sisters-in-law and many nieces, nephews, cousins, and a few great-aunts and great-uncles. Jona is a United States Army Vietnam Service Veteran and a member of DAV, Chapter VA29.
